CHICAGO, Ill. -- Senior guard Kolden Vanlandingham's standalone performance against UW-Stevens Point last week saw him earn College Conference of Illinois & Wisconsin (CCIW) Player of the Week honors on Monday afternoon. He received more exclusive honors early Tuesday morning, landing on the D3hoops.com National Team of the Week.
Vanlandingham led North Park to a triple-overtime win over UW-Stevens Point on Saturday, posting career highs in points and assists, with 39 and 10 respectively. 24 of those 39 points arrived in a pivotal second half to help the Vikings climb back from down 17 points to force extra play en route to the win. He was the focal point of the offense throughout the game, shooting 61% from the field and 50% (5-10) from the three point line. He also had two steals in the game.
Vanlandingham and the Vikings are back in action on Wednesday, December 3, for a game at Carroll University.
